WE felt we had to reply to the article written by Graeme Robertson and headlined "Tight squeeze for Alley Cats" (Life&Times, July 23).

We would like to share with readers our own Alley Cat experiences of candlelit, cosy winter evenings, sharing a good bottle of house wine served in chilled glasses along with an appetising combo, carefully chosen background music, and friendly staff.

The intimacy of the bar area is a bonus, but if this is not to your taste there is a more spacious setting upstairs.

We feel that any change, given the age and size of this old building, would damage the unique character and special ambience.

Although we sympathise with parents of small children and wheelchair users, in York we are very lucky that there is a wide variety of places to eat that could accommodate their needs.
